Do you enjoy building things and solving problems? Ever wonder how things work? The many objects we take for granted every day are a direct result of the work of many dedicating Engineering Technicians working to assist Engineers by testing materials, drafting reports and creating plans. Engineering Technology focuses on the technical aspects of engineering. A curiosity for the way things operate is what inspires engineering technology. Collecting data and conducting experiments, building and designing new ideas for products are all things that a student in engineering technology would learn.
Course load for this field includes automated manufacturing technology, computers for engineering technology, construction methodology and procedures, and technical drawing. This major can be completed as an Associates or Bachelors.

An absorbing interest in the way things work is crucial for success, as well as creativity and a hands-on approach to learning. Knowledge of mathematics and science are essential for this major. Heavily focused on these two foundations, an individual with a love for analyzing and problem solving could be very successful in this field.
Although not required, you can prepare for the major by taking classes in high school on electronics, physics, computer science, and calculus; this allows you to get a taste of what engineering technology encompasses.

There are several general engineering technology degree levels. The table below shows the typical length of the most common levels, and how many graduates earn each one.
| Degree | Typical Program Length | Graduates Annually |
|---|---|---|
| Certificate | Varies | 194 |
| Associate Degree | 2 years | 1,256 |
| Bachelor’s Degree | 4 years | 1,337 |
| Master’s Degree | 1-3 years | 1,076 |
| Doctorate | At least 4 years | 5 |
People currently working in careers related to general engineering technology tend to have obtained the following education levels.
| Level of Education | Percentage of Workers |
|---|---|
| Associate’s degree (or other 2-year) | 26.6% |
| Postsecondary certificate | 20.3% |
| High school diploma or equivalent | 19.2% |
| Bachelor’s degree | 12.9% |
| Some college courses | 11.4% |
| Doctoral degree | 3.7% |
| Master’s degree | 3.1% |
| Less than a high school diploma | 1.4% |
| Post-baccalaureate certificate | 0.7% |
| Post-doctoral training | 0.6% |

A degree in Engineering Technology provides students with a broad set of skills. Entering the workforce, students will be prepared to assist engineers to develop and manufacture new products and services. Engineer technicians will draw up drafts for projects; conduct lab experiments and solve complex problems and make new discoveries.

College Scorecard reports median earnings of general engineering technology graduates 1, 4, and 5 years after completion. These numbers tend to grow as graduates gain experience.
| Years Out | Median Earnings |
|---|---|
| 1 year | $60,327 |
| 4 years | $67,578 |
| 5 years | $74,923 |
Source: U.S. Department of Education College Scorecard, field-of-study earnings tracker.
